Arrabelle Club Ski Valet - Full Time, Winter Seasonal, Vail Mountain
The ski valet is responsible for creating a welcoming first impression to Arrabelle Club members, a timely delivery, retrieval and storage of skis and equipment. Provide immediate and courteous member service. Communicate with various departments to notify internal staff of member arrival and/or needs. Responsible for cleanliness of Club and surrounding work environments.
Responsibilities Include (but are not limited to):
- Valet all member’s and guest’s ski equipment with applicable labels, put into Jonas ski inventory, and stored in an organized fashion.
- Front desk, fill in when necessary. Moving of member vehicles when applicable.
- Locates and delivers members’ and guests’ ski equipment to member when member and/or guest arrive each day to go skiing.
- Receives and transports members and guests skis to ski storage at the end of ski day or when member and/or guest are done skiing for the day. Records daily inventory of all skis at close of business.
- Document all ski tuning instructions, coordination and transport equipment to and from the ski shop.
- Keep a daily log of all ski activity.
- Changes light bulbs, performs minor maintenance as needed.
- Assists food and beverage staff with daily services.
- Make cookies and present them in the Club Room with milk daily.
- Maintain cleanliness of the Club facility for guest arrival.
- Assists with cleaning the club room, restroom, and all public areas.
- Problem solves member issues within authority level, direct to upper management for decisions.
- 50% of job is outdoors.
- Other duties as assigned.
Qualifications:
- The ability to work in a fast paced, multi-tasked environment with high profile members. Presents excellent communication skills, both written and oral are essential.
- Valid U.S. driver’s license and have a clean driving record - required.
- Ability to arrive on time and in uniform ready to work by 7:30am - required.
- Ability to consistently lift 50 pounds and stand for several hours at a time - required.
- Ability to carry up to 50 lbs of skis/snowboards safely - required.
- Willingness and ability to work outside in winter conditions - required.
